Design of Nonzero Dispersion Flattened Fiber Amplifier Optimized for S-Band Optical Communication

Not Accessible

Your library or personal account may give you access

Abstract

We present a new design of dispersion flattened optical fiber for flat nonzero dispersion in the S-band region. The optimized parameters of optical fiber are used to find the optimum concentration of Tm-ions in Tm-doped optical fiber, which is further analyzed for the gain and noise performance. It is found that about 5000 mW of pumping power at 1.064 <i>µ</i>m is required to obtain 15 dB gain at 1.47 <i>µ</i>m in the silica glass Tm-doped (dispersion flattened) optical fiber.
